Trek to Kedarnath distance

The journey of 18 km to Kedarnath starts in Gaurikund and concludes in Kedarnath. The 14km trek to Kedarnath is now 16 km as due to the 2013 Uttarakhand floods.

The Kedarnath Trek Route Map

The 18-kilometer Kedarnath trek starts from Gaurikund. Prior to that, a well-maintained secure, and safe trek route was established from Rambara. Following the tragedy of 2013 and the subsequent government changes, the government has changed the Kedarnath trek route due to the fact that the original route was totally gone. 

The travel guide for Kedarnath Trek Kedarnath Trek follows an overview of the New Trek Route, which is available below.

  • From Sonprayag to take a taxi shared with others to Gaurikund (6 km, or approximately).
  • Rambara Bridge connects Gaurikund and Jungle Chatti, a distance of 6 kilometers.
  • to Bheembali From the rainforest (4km)
  • to Linchauli to Linchauli Bheembali (3km)
  • Kedarnath Base Camp to Linchauli (4km)
  • The Kedarnath Temple from Kedarnath Base Camp (1km)

Kedarnath Trek Features

The 18.4-kilometer Kedarnath Trek is a moderate to strenuous hike that requires an extremely high fitness level. All pilgrims must test their fitness before embarking for a hike to assess their fitness and whether they’re capable of doing the task. This trek from Gaurikund Kedarnath Trek from Gaurikund is scheduled to take place between 4:00 AM and 12:30 PM. 

Due to the fact that Kedarnath is located in the Kedarnath Wildlife Sanctuary and the inability of pilgrims to travel at any given time, the timing has been set. It is suggested that anyone suffering from respiratory problems consult a physician prior to beginning the trek at this altitude.

Facilities at the Kedarnath Trek

Palki/Dandi Kandi and Mule/Ponies can be rented to use for the duration of this Kedarnath Trek. At the desk of reservation in the Gaurikund/Sonprayag area, anyone can reserve these services. The cost for traveling between Gaurikund up to Kedarnath is the sum of Rs. 4450, whereas the cost of travel to Kandi is 3350 rupees. 3350. The price to travel to Poni is 4450. 

The cost to travel from Poni is. 4100. The trek’s path is lined with restaurants/shops, drinking water, and camping in tents, all of which have adequate facilities. It is worth noting that the Kedarnath Helipad offers helicopter service to Phata as well as other helipads in addition.
